Software Compliance & Engagement Specialist

Location: Remote (Must be based in Mainland China)
Type: Full-Time Contractor (3-month trial period)
Pay: ~$2,500 USD / month ($30,000 Annual Equivalent) + KPI-driven Performance Bonuses
Top Requirements: Native Mandarin Speaker, Fluent English, 1+ years experience in Sales, License Compliance or Customer Engagement.

We are seeking a driven and highly communicative professional based in China to manage software compliance and anti-piracy cases within the region. This is a full-time contractor position beginning with a 3-month trial period to ensure mutual fit, followed by a 2-year renewable contract. You will be the crucial bridge between our investigative data and the businesses we engage with, taking ownership of cases from the first contact through to resolution.

WHAT YOU WILL BE DOING

  • Case Management: Managing the full lifecycle of software compliance and anti-piracy cases within the Chinese market.
  • Direct Engagement: Proactively engaging with businesses via calls, emails, and virtual meetings to resolve compliance issues.
  • Data Analysis: Analyzing investigation data and organizing findings meticulously using CRM tools.
  • Strategy & Outreach: Generating leads and optimizing regional outreach strategies specifically tailored to the Mandarin-speaking business landscape.
  • Reporting: Providing ad hoc reports and strategic insights to support ongoing business growth.

CANDIDATE REQUIREMENTS

  • Location & Language: Must be based in China. Native Mandarin proficiency (spoken and written) is essential, alongside fluent English.
  • Experience: 1+ years in customer engagement, sales, or support (a sales-driven/B2B background is highly preferred).
  • Technical Aptitude: Familiarity with CRM systems, data analysis tools, and proficiency in Google Sheets/Excel.
  • Work Style: Proven ability to work independently in a remote setting and thrive in a KPI-driven environment.
  • Soft Skills: Exceptional negotiation abilities and a deep understanding of Chinese business etiquette and communication culture.

BONUS POINTS FOR:

  • Prior experience in corporate compliance or IP protection.
  • A resilient, problem-solving mindset with the ability to thrive under pressure.
  • Demonstrated experience in B2B sales or corporate engagement.
